Description
Hi Flowbite Team,
I encountered a minor issue with your website's search popup feature. When using the 'Ctrl + K' keyboard shortcut to open the search popup, multiple instances of the popup can appear if the shortcut is pressed more than once in quick succession. While this doesn’t happen every single time, it happens intermittently and leads to multiple popups being displayed simultaneously.
The expected behavior would be for only one popup to appear at a time, and for repeated 'Ctrl + K' presses to either focus the existing popup or close it.
